AI Contract Overview
The contract requires comprehensive cleaning and restoration of air handling unit coils at a VA medical facility to eliminate biofilm, debris, and other contaminants that impair thermal efficiency and airflow. The scope of work demands meticulous removal of accumulated biological and particulate matter to restore the coils to optimal operational condition, ensuring the HVAC system meets stringent indoor air quality and performance standards critical in a healthcare environment. All work must be performed in compliance with industry best practices for sanitation and mechanical integrity, with no disruption to ongoing patient care operations. This is a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) set-aside subcontract under NAICS code 238220, exclusively available to qualified SDVOSB contractors. The solicitation was posted on July 31, 2026, with proposals due by August 7, 2026, and is managed by the Department of Veterans Affairs through the 247-NETWORK Contract Office 7. The work will take place at a VA medical facility, and contractors must be prepared to adhere to federal healthcare facility protocols, including infection control, safety regulations, and coordination with facility personnel during execution.
